Originally Posted by 96xjclassic
Dukie can you show me a picture of which vacuum line to take off and stick in a can of seafoam?
The brake booster. The round black piece behind te brake reservoir. Pry it out carefully and with a funnel slowly pour it in In 3rds. At the last third flood her so she stalls out and let her sit doe 15 mins. I know you wanted a pic but I wanted to help you before dukie did since dukie helped about 47.5 ppl today lol

Originally Posted by 96xjclassic
Just dump it right in the valve cover oil fill hole?
yup the same one we dumb oil in. You can also you a quart of tranny fluid i here but im more accustom to this. Its 1.5oz per quart of oil in there and make sure you dont drive more than 100 miles with it in there. Its gonna clean the heck outta it. Your next oil change will be black as a hole. Also run a quart of oil through as a sacrfice to gett everything out

Originally Posted by 96xjclassic
I've heard of the tranny fluid thing, I'm just scared to try. However I will gladly do the seafoam thing. I've got an oil change coming up in a few hundred miles as a matter of fact!Yes more seafoam!
I think my last post wasn't written well did it on my phone. So yea when you're about 100 miles left run about 8oz and only that into you oil and when you do your oil change sacrifice an extra quart of oil and run it through the engine with drain plug open just to make sure everything is out. Then fill her up and you're golden. Also you can run a full can of seafoam into your empty gas tank and fill up with your favorite gas.
